Hi, I am very green to mercruiser engines or any engine for that matter. I have found a couple of leaks on my new boat and would really appreciate some help.

The first leak from the exhaust bellow. The rubber looks out of shape so assume needs replacing? Question is is it an easy job, just remove and replace with new exhaust clamps?

Second leak from power trim fluid reservoir. Is this likely to just need new reservoir?

Engines are 350mpi.

Many thanks in advance.
 
Last edited:
The rubber exhaust coupling is probably going to need replacement. On the trim hoses, it's difficult to say whether those are bad, or if the fittings on the pump are loose. I would say to dry off the hoses, check the fittings, then run the trim up and down to see if it still leaks. If it is the hoses, new ones are in order.

Ayuh,..... I'd just tighten the hose clamps on the exhaust coupler,..... don't look that bad to me,.....
That can sometimes be an odd fittin' joint,....

The trim pump, I believe has a big o-ring, where the pump meets the tank,.....
'n I think the bolt that holds the tank, comes up through the bottom,....
Could be a loose bolt,....
